DSNTEJ1T

THIS JCL LOADS THE SYSIBM.

//**********************************************************************00010000
//*  NAME = DSNTEJ1T                                                   *00020000
//*                                                                    *00030000
//*  DESCRIPTIVE NAME = DB2 SAMPLE APPLICATION                         *00040000
//*                     PHASE 1 (LOCAL SITE ONLY)                      *00050000
//*                                                                    *00060000
//*    LICENSED MATERIALS - PROPERTY OF IBM                            *00070000
//*    5675-DB2                                                        *00080000
//*    (C) COPYRIGHT 1982, 2000 IBM CORP.  ALL RIGHTS RESERVED.        *00090000
//*                                                                    *00100000
//*    STATUS = VERSION 7                                              *00110000
//*                                                                    *00120000
//*  FUNCTION = THIS JCL LOADS THE SYSIBM.SYSSTRINGS TABLE WITH ROWS   *00130000
//*             WHICH DESCRIBE CODE PAGE CONVERSION FROM RS/6000 TO    *00140000
//*             DB2.                                                   *00150000
//*                                                                    *00160000
//*  *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* *   *00170000
//*  * NOTE: DO -NOT- RUN THIS JOB AS PART OF THE DB2 INSTALLATION *   *00180000
//*  *       VERIFICATION PROCESS (IVP).  USE IT -ONLY- TO ADD     *   *00190000
//*  *       CODE PAGE CONVERSION DATA TO SYSIBM.SYSSTRINGS.  SEE  *   *00200000
//*  *       SEE APPENDIX B OF THE DB2 INSTALLATION GUIDE FOR IN-  *   *00210000
//*  *       FORMATION ABOUT ADDING CODE PAGE CONVERSION DATA.     *   *00220000
//*  *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* *   *00230000
//*                                                                    *00240000
//*  NOTICE =                                                          *00250000
//*    THIS SAMPLE JOB USES DB2 UTILITIES. SOME UTILITY FUNCTIONS ARE  *00260000
//*    ELEMENTS OF SEPARATELY ORDERABLE PRODUCTS.  SUCCESSFUL USE OF   *00270000
//*    A PARTICULAR SAMPLE JOB MAY BE DEPENDENT UPON THE OPTIONAL      *00280000
//*    PRODUCT BEING LICENSED AND INSTALLED IN YOUR ENVIRONMENT.       *00290000
//*                                                                    *00300000
//* CHANGE ACTIVITY =                                                  *00310000
//**********************************************************************00320000
//*                                                                     00330000
//*                                                                     00340000
//JOBLIB  DD  DSN=DSN!!0.SDSNLOAD,DISP=SHR                              00350000
//*                                                                     00360000
//*        LOAD DATA INTO SYSIBM.SYSSTRINGS TABLE                       00370000
//PH01TS01 EXEC DSNUPROC,PARM='DSN,DSNTEX'                              00380000
//SORTLIB  DD  DSN=SYS1.SORTLIB,DISP=SHR                                00390000
//SORTOUT  DD  UNIT=SYSDA,SPACE=(4000,(20,20),,,ROUND)                  00400000
//SORTWK01 DD  UNIT=SYSDA,SPACE=(4000,(20,20),,,ROUND)                  00410000
//SORTWK02 DD  UNIT=SYSDA,SPACE=(4000,(20,20),,,ROUND)                  00420000
//SORTWK03 DD  UNIT=SYSDA,SPACE=(4000,(20,20),,,ROUND)                  00430000
//SORTWK04 DD  UNIT=SYSDA,SPACE=(4000,(20,20),,,ROUND)                  00440000
//DSNTRACE DD  SYSOUT=*                                                 00450000
//SYSRECST DD  DSN=DSN!!0.SDSNSAMP(DSN8LST),                            00460000
//             DISP=SHR                                                 00470000
//SYSUT1   DD  UNIT=SYSDA,SPACE=(4000,(50,50),,,ROUND)                  00480000
//SYSIN    DD  *                                                        00490000
                                                                        00500000
 LOAD DATA INDDN(SYSRECST) CONTINUEIF(80:80)='X' RESUME(YES)            00510000
      INTO TABLE SYSIBM.SYSSTRINGS                                      00520000
           (INCCSID   POSITION(  1) INTEGER EXTERNAL(5),                00530000
            OUTCCSID  POSITION(  7) INTEGER EXTERNAL(5),                00540000
            TRANSTYPE POSITION( 13) CHAR(2),                            00550000
            ERRORBYTE POSITION( 16) CHAR(1) NULLIF(ERRORBYTE=' '),      00560000
            SUBBYTE   POSITION( 18) CHAR(1) NULLIF(SUBBYTE=' '),        00570000
            TRANSPROC POSITION( 20) CHAR(8),                            00580000
            IBMREQD   POSITION( 29) CHAR(1),                            00590000
            TRANSTAB  POSITION( 31) CHAR(256)                           00600000
              DEFAULTIF(TRANSTYPE='GG'))                                00610000
//*                                                                     00620000